Lake County, Indiana

Lake County, Indiana is adjacent to Illinois. This county is known for the amazing Indiana Dunes National Lakeshore, with its many trails and beaches to explore. Lake County, Indiana is home to many cities and suburbs like Gary, Crown Point, Merrillville, Munster, Hammond, Hobart, East Chicago, and Cedar Lakes.
